Title :
A millimeter-wave cavity-backed suspended substrate stripline antenna

Abstract :
In this paper, the design, fabrication and characterization of a V-band (50-75 GHz) 4/spl times/4 planar array of cavity backed circular aperture antennas with suspended substrate stripline corporate feed is presented for potential applications in satellite communications. The measured radiation patterns of a single circular aperture show excellent characteristics.
